Yeah, you will now because they haven't implemented tiered pricing yet. The question really is when they do implement it (and it was mentioned by Verizon that it would be mid-summer), how will they handle customers that are already on the unlimited plan? If they grandfather in those already on the unlimited plan, that might be the best option. In that case, they'd (likely) have unlimited data until they upgrade/renew their contract. Since upgrading/renewing the contract is basically signing a new contract, they'd be subject to whatever the pricing plan is at that time (i.e., tiered pricing). However, if they buy a phone at retail instead of upgrading, then the contract wouldn't be altered and may remain unlimited.
